The Montgomery Police Department is actively working to terminate a police corporal after he or she used racially insensitive language when speaking to a Montgomery Public School student.
School and law enforcement officials say the incident happened during school hours on September 3, and it was witnessed by individuals at an unnamed school.
MPS spokesperson, Tom Salter confirms the school system reported the incident to MPD. After MPD learned of the alleged conversation, the officer was removed from the school and assigned to administrative duties. Another officer was immediately sent to the school as a replacement to continue duties at the school.
Officials with the Montgomery Police Department say the Office of City Investigations is looking into the allegations. The officer will remain on administrative duties pending conclusion of both the investigation and disciplinary procedures.
Authorities are not releasing any other details about the incident, including the location of the school, at this time citing an ongoing investigation involving personnel matters.
